Pinpointing a Phone Using IMEI

Recovering a lost mobile can be a challenging endeavor, but utilizing its distinctive IMEI identifier offers a practical approach. The IMEI, or International Mobile Equipment Identity, is a sequence assigned to each device at the time of manufacture and acts as its fingerprint. While directly locating a mobile solely through IMEI isn’t always possible for the common user without assistance, several tools leverage this code with copyright cooperation. This often involves contacting the device's copyright and law agencies, who have the capacity to launch a trace based on the provided IMEI. It’s important to note that privacy considerations are paramount, and unauthorized monitoring is unlawful in many jurisdictions.

Can Phone Contact Tracking Become Achievable?

The question of whether phone contact tracing is feasible has fueled considerable discussion and misinformation online. Historically, the concept conjured images of instant site disclosure, but the truth is considerably more intricate. While systems exist that *can* determine the general local area associated with a mobile digit—typically within a radius of several units—they are not inherently designed for individual individual following. These techniques often rely on radio triangulation or connection details, which provide rough placement, not a exact address. Furthermore, stringent confidentiality laws and copyright controls severely hinder the ease with which such data can be retrieved, particularly by ordinary citizens. Therefore, while limited location is practically achievable, the general idea of simply location a phone number is largely a myth.
